Charmin
Charmin Ultra Soft Toilet Paper 9 Mega Rolls = 36 Regular Rolls
Order within 21 hours and 8 minutes to get between May 27th - June 3rd
Buying Bulk?Tracked Shipping on All Orders Secure Payments
24/7 Customer Support14 Days Returns
Description